Pickit files. Lets say I have this:
Code: [Type] == amulet && [Quality] == unique //All Uniques
[Type] == amulet && [Quality] == unique # [Strength] == 12 && [ColdResist] >= 25 // Saracen's Chance
[Type] == amulet && [Quality] == unique # [Dexterity] == 25 // The Cat's Eye
When pickit grabs or checks if an item is to be kept, it sees a unique amulet, which matches that first line. Since it already matches, id is not required to see if it has the properties for those other lines. Simple?
Also check that stash has space. If your stash has no space, the bot will hold the item and attempt to 'log' an item every time it does it's keep-check (between every boss).
